A pleasure selfie is a selfie taken that has no more than one person. The person is usual smiling, looking serious or sometimes even smizing (smiling with their eyes). A pleasure selfie is most commonly posted on Instagram with the caption being a quote about love, heartbreak, loss, sadness, happiness, the opposite sex. Pleasure-Selfie takers also use captions such as "I'm so ugly", "Deleting soon", Not sure about this' and the good old "#ewmyface" these captions are used for people to say "Oh no, you're beautiful" or "Don't delete you're gorgeous". These Pleasure-Selfie takers can be found in many places so watch and always keep one eye open.

A self-imposed image taken with a selfie camera usually expressing a picture of person’s face after a successful moment of self-accomplishment performing a task that nobody but the picture taker cares about. This selfie can also occur in the moments of a person’s boredom where it is accompanied by a philosophical reference or caption expressing a deep lesson learned, an important self-accomplishment or very insightful self-awareness.
Such photos are meant to socially establish credibility of profound wisdom to the person posting the image and caption about themselves, but often the reference is shallow at best, and serves the purpose of attention seeking individuals who have low self-esteem, little credibility, and little wisdom, if any on the philosophical message emphasized.
Lastly, images are usually of the persons face looking glaringly empty into space or directly at the camera, or after a period of physical exertion to emphasize the struggle that led to such credibility.
